$299.00 Summary: I bought this flash for two reasons:
-HSS (High-Speed Sync): flash will sync at ANY speed on my Maxxum 7. Nice for using shallow depth-of-field on bright sunny days with fast film, and freezing really fast action.
-Power: has a maximum range of 177ft. @ 105mm. Strengths: Large, VERY powerful, "test" button, backlit LCD display, ft. and m., fairly easy to use and well thought-out controls, HSS (of course), swivel/bounce head, 24mm lens coverage... plus many other features (wireless, etc.) I havent used a lot, but will grow into. Weaknesses: Not cheap, but good things cost money. Price may come down since the introduction of the new 5600HS(D). HSS has a maximum range of 62ft. Lithium 'AA' batteries not recommended for use with this flash?...refer to operating manual, or contact Minolta directly.
